Adobe Dreamweaver CS3: ColdFusion Application Development provides students with the knowledge and hands-on practice they need to build and manage dynamic websites using Dreamweaver and ColdFusion. In this course, you ll learn how to connect to a database, search and display results, and build a page to update the database. If you ve always dreamed of building a more advanced, data-powered site, but didn't know where to start, then this course is for you.
This course is for people new to Dreamweaver (or who have used it only to build static web sites) that want to use it to create data-driven web applications. To take this course, you should:
Be comfortable working with the Windows or Macintosh operating system.
Be familiar with web terminology.
Be comfortable with what is required to develop a static web application.
Have completed the Adobe Dreamweaver CS3: Website Development course or have equivalent experience.

Unit 1: Introducing the Course
Understanding the course format
Reviewing the course objectives and prerequisites
Looking at the course outline
Unit 2: Getting Started
Understanding static vs. dynamic pages
Introducing ColdFusion
Working with sites in Dreamweaver
Learning Dreamweaver interface basics
Developing dynamic pages
Including common code
Unit 3: Using the Database Panel
Using databases on the web
Creating a database connection
Using the Database panel
Using the Bindings panel to create a simple recordset
Creating an advanced recordset using joins
Unit 4: Binding Data to a Page
Binding data to a page
Using Live Data View
Formatting data using the Bindings panel
Inserting a dynamic image
Unit 5: Customizing Recordset Display
Introducing Server Behaviors
Displaying all rows in a recordset using Repeat Region
Introducing Application Objects
Using the Recordset Navigation Bar to page through recordsets
Displaying Recordset Navigation Status
Using the Server Debug View
Unit 6: Creating Drill-down Interfaces
Creating a drill-down interface
Generating dynamic links
Using dynamic filters in SQL
Using the Dynamic Table Application Object
Creating a master-detail page set
Unit 7: Creating a Search Interface
Reviewing HTML Forms
Creating dynamically populated drop-down menus
Creating filtered recordsets
Unit 8: Inserting Rows into a Table
Creating a form and using the Insert Record Server Behavior
Validating form data using Behaviors
Creating dynamic form elements
Using the Recordset Insertion Form Application Object
Unit 9: Updating Rows
Creating an interface for updating data
Displaying results in a table using the Dynamic Table Application Object
Creating a pre-filled form for the row to update
Using URL parameters
Using the Record Update Form Application Object
Manually creating a form and applying an Update Record Server Behavior
